Infra-red Sauna

Relaxing in a sauna is one of the best ways to open your pores and eliminate toxins. A traditional sauna uses fire, gas or electricity to heat the air around you. An infra-red sauna heats the body directly through the use of infrared lamps. This means the air in an infra-red sauna is drier, the heating is slower, and the temperatures not as high, so it’s a much more comfortable experience for you.

Incandescent Sauna

An incandescent or near infra-red sauna produces the shortest infrared wavelength, which penetrates the skin’s surface more effectively. It’s ideal for reducing pain and inflammation quickly but the heat is more intense than our infra-red sauna.

Frequently asked questions

What are infra-red saunas?

Infra-red saunas use infra-red lamps to heat the body. The invisible wavelengths penetrate into your body to relax muscles, relieve pain, and improve circulation and healing. The heating is different to that of a traditional sauna (which heats the air around you) so it’s a much more comfortable experience.

Who should be careful when using an infra-red sauna?

Infra-red saunas are not for everyone. If you’re unsure, check with us first. We advise caution if you are:

- Under 18 years old
- Over 55 years old
- Have cardiovascular conditions
- Prone to bleeding
- Pregnant
- Suffering from a chronic health condition
